Tin Ceiling Repair refers to the process of fixing or restoring tin ceilings that have been damaged or deteriorated over time. Tin ceilings are decorative ceiling panels made of tin-coated steel or aluminum, often found in older buildings. Common issues that may require repair include rust, corrosion, dents, or loose panels. Repairing a tin ceiling typically involves cleaning the surface, removing any damaged sections, and replacing them with new tin panels or using specialized techniques to restore the original appearance.
